
Recherche avancée
Autres articles (97)
-
Multilang : améliorer l’interface pour les blocs multilingues
18 février 2011, parMultilang est un plugin supplémentaire qui n’est pas activé par défaut lors de l’initialisation de MediaSPIP.
Après son activation, une préconfiguration est mise en place automatiquement par MediaSPIP init permettant à la nouvelle fonctionnalité d’être automatiquement opérationnelle. Il n’est donc pas obligatoire de passer par une étape de configuration pour cela. -
Gestion des droits de création et d’édition des objets
8 février 2011, parPar défaut, beaucoup de fonctionnalités sont limitées aux administrateurs mais restent configurables indépendamment pour modifier leur statut minimal d’utilisation notamment : la rédaction de contenus sur le site modifiables dans la gestion des templates de formulaires ; l’ajout de notes aux articles ; l’ajout de légendes et d’annotations sur les images ;
-
Dépôt de média et thèmes par FTP
31 mai 2013, parL’outil MédiaSPIP traite aussi les média transférés par la voie FTP. Si vous préférez déposer par cette voie, récupérez les identifiants d’accès vers votre site MédiaSPIP et utilisez votre client FTP favori.
Vous trouverez dès le départ les dossiers suivants dans votre espace FTP : config/ : dossier de configuration du site IMG/ : dossier des média déjà traités et en ligne sur le site local/ : répertoire cache du site web themes/ : les thèmes ou les feuilles de style personnalisées tmp/ : dossier de travail (...)
Sur d’autres sites (10228)
-
ffmpeg FPS information mismatch with the video
8 décembre 2017, par AdornI have a bunch of videos with some statistics of what is happening inside a video. One such piece of information is given in terms of time of the video in seconds up to one decimal point.
To get the FPS of a video, I am using
ffmpeg -i
But when I manually compute one particular frame’s time using given FPS, it does not match.
For example, ffmpeg outputs FPS = 30.
I look at the video statistics, the frame at the 156.8 = 2.368 has to be
4704'th
frame. I open the video using ’skvideo’, read all the frames, and view the4704'th
frame. It is some frame around time 2.12 ?. I checked multiple such instances in multiple videos and this is a common behavior.I do not understand why this is so and how can I get around the problem ?
As such I am not bounded by ffmpeg. Skvideo is being used to read the videos. I tried
opencv
, as of now it does not work withVideoCapture
, and reinstalling it is costly for me time wise. But I guess ’opencv/skvideo’ should not matter, one can count the frames manually as well.So, in the solution, I am looking out for -
-
Given timestamps of inside of a video, how can I find a frame of that particular time location ?
-
In case someone might have already worked on this, this is related to
THUMOS
dataset. I am on Ubuntu 16.04
EDIT_1
Actually I can be more specific as it is a publicly available data. The time bounds are of an important activity. For example, in a video, when does basketball dunk occurs ? It is given in pairs - [start end]. Some videos have multiple activities, some have only one.
Here is a sample video, and following are the activity times.
[[ 16.5, 20.8],
[ 26.6, 32.2],
[ 34.8, 42.1],
[ 47.8, 50.0],
[ 58.1, 62.9],
[ 65.6, 67.2],
[ 68.5, 74.0],
[ 76.4, 78.3],
[ 78.7, 79.8],
[ 80.8, 82.1],
[ 85.0, 87.3],
[ 90.1, 91.4],
[ 98.5, 100.3]]I also tried checking manually, 32.87 FPS "almost" works for few videos but not for all. and almost means it is off by 10 frames. This is a huge difference for my task, and I need exact frame.
Also, there has to be some way, because it can be visually observed with multiple video players that times in the dataset are correct.
-
-
avcodec/dnxhddec : Do not overwrite colorspace if the container has set it.
29 novembre 2017, par Steven Robertsonavcodec/dnxhddec : Do not overwrite colorspace if the container has set it.
The existing logic overrides container metadata even in cases where the
container metadata must be trusted (e.g. HDR). The original spec had no
provision for specifying color volume, so many files rely on the
assumption of Rec. 709.An update to the spec included a 'clv' field for explicitly signaling
that the container should be trusted in an existing bitfield in the
frame header, but the default of 0 from old encoders forces Rec. 709,
which would break any HDR stream. Because there is no place in DNxHR for
specifying a transfer function, DNxHR HDR files must include
container-level color information.This patch maintains the existing behavior of choosing the 709 over the
601 matrix when container-level information is missing, and allows
container-level information to win if present.Signed-off-by : Steven Robertson <steven@strobe.cc>
Signed-off-by : Michael Niedermayer <michael@niedermayer.cc> -
hwcontext_vaapi : Do not assume that sw_format is transferable
24 novembre 2017, par Mark Thompson